About the role
The Product Owner is the single point of accountability for driving value delivery to our clients and their end customers.
Your job is to understand the business problem from the client's perspective, guide them to the solution that meets their need, align stakeholders, and prescribe the highest-value path forward. On the other side of that, you make sure the engineering team is always working on the right things, at the right time, with clear outcomes.
The person who does well here moves past backlog management: they challenge assumptions and recommend approaches aligned to business goals, user needs, and platform capabilities.
What you'll do
- Client and outcome ownership. Be the primary client-facing product partner. Lead discovery to understand business objectives, success metrics, and constraints, not just feature requests.
- Requirements translation. Turn client needs into clear requirements achievable through sprints and tied to measurable business value.
- Risk and opportunity. Identify risks and gaps early, and present trade-offs to stakeholders.
- Product strategy. Define and maintain vision and roadmap rooted in outcomes. Prioritize on value, impact, risk, and effort. Challenge scope to prevent overengineering.
- Delivery leadership. Own the backlog in an Agile environment, define acceptance criteria with engineering, QA, and UX, and facilitate refinement, planning, and demos.
- Validation. Run acceptance testing and validate solutions against the intended business outcomes.
- Cross-functional advisory. Bridge business and technical teams, and support presales, solution design, and QBRs.
